The global silicon oxide nanoparticle market was valued at USD 4,974 million in 2023 and is projected to reach USD 7,729.53 million by 2030, growing at a compound annual growth rate (CAGR) of 6.5% during the forecast period. This rapid expansion is fueled by surging demand from electronics manufacturers, solar energy companies, and biomedical researchers – all leveraging the unique properties of these advanced nanomaterials.
As industries increasingly adopt nanotechnology solutions for enhanced performance and sustainability, these nanoparticles have become critical components in semiconductors, drug delivery systems, and environmental applications. 🔟 1. American Elements
Headquarters: Los Angeles, California, USA
Key Offering: High-purity SiO₂ nanoparticles in powder and colloidal forms
American Elements maintains one of the industry’s most extensive nanotechnology portfolios, supplying engineered silica nanoparticles to research institutions and industrial clients worldwide. Their proprietary manufacturing processes enable precise control over particle size distribution from 5-100nm.
Technology Initiatives:
- Surface functionalization for targeted applications
- GMP-grade production for pharmaceutical applications
- Custom nanoparticle synthesis services

9️⃣ 2. SkySpring Nanomaterials
Headquarters: Houston, Texas, USA
Key Offering: Precision-engineered silica nanoparticles (10-500nm)
Specializing in high-volume nanomaterials production, SkySpring serves semiconductor and coating manufacturers with tailored silica solutions. Their recent capacity expansion addresses growing demand from Asian electronics markets.
Technology Initiatives:
- Anti-reflective coating formulations
- Semiconductor-grade purity standards
- Large-scale synthesis optimization
8️⃣ 3. Meliorum Technologies
Headquarters: Rochester, New York, USA
Key Offering: Functionalized silica nanoparticles for biomedical use
Meliorum’s surface-modified nanoparticles enable breakthrough applications in drug delivery and medical imaging. The company holds multiple patents for its bio-conjugation technologies.
Technology Initiatives:
- Targeted cancer therapeutics carriers
- Contrast agents for diagnostic imaging
- Biocompatibility enhancement research
7️⃣ 4. Fuso Chemical
Headquarters: Osaka, Japan
Key Offering: Ultra-high-purity colloidal silica
As Asia’s leading colloidal silica producer, Fuso Chemical supplies the region’s booming semiconductor and display industries. Their recent partnership with TSMC highlights their pivotal role in advanced chip manufacturing.
Technology Initiatives:
- Defect-reduction formulations for EUV lithography
- Automotive-grade nanopowders
- Water-based dispersion technologies

6️⃣ 5. US Research Nanomaterials
Headquarters: Houston, Texas, USA
Key Offering: Research-grade SiO₂ nanoparticles and characterization services
This Texas-based firm supports academic and corporate R&D with specialized nanomaterials and analytical services, bridging the gap between laboratory discovery and commercial application.
Technology Initiatives:
- Custom particle size distribution synthesis
- Surface area and porosity characterization
- Nanotoxicology testing services
5️⃣ 6. Hongwu International Group
Headquarters: Guangzhou, China
Key Offering: Cost-effective industrial silica nanoparticles
Hongwu has emerged as China’s volume leader in nanoparticle production, serving domestic manufacturers across multiple industries with competitively-priced, quality nanomaterials.
Technology Initiatives:
- Large-scale hydrothermal synthesis
- Battery material enhancements
- Photocatalytic coatings
4️⃣ 7. Admatechs
Headquarters: Shizuoka, Japan
Key Offering: Spherical silica for electronics encapsulation
Admatechs’ proprietary sphericalization technology produces perfectly uniform particles critical for semiconductor packaging and LED applications, commanding premium pricing in specialized markets.
Technology Initiatives:
- Ultra-low alpha particle formulations
- Thermal interface materials
- Epoxy composite enhancements
3️⃣ 8. NanoAmor
Headquarters: Houston, Texas, USA
Key Offering: Multi-functional silica nanocomposites
By combining silica nanoparticles with other nanomaterials, NanoAmor creates hybrid materials with enhanced properties for aerospace, energy storage, and specialty coating applications.
Technology Initiatives:
- Nanocomposite design services
- Surface plasmon resonance tuning
- Multi-phase material integration
2️⃣ 9. Evonik Industries
Headquarters: Essen, Germany
Key Offering: AEROSIL® fumed silica products
This German chemical giant produces high-performance fumed silica nanoparticles through flame pyrolysis, commanding significant market share in Europe and North America.
Technology Initiatives:
- Rheology modification additives
- Free-flow agents for powders
- Reinforcement fillers
1️⃣ 10. Nanoshel
Headquarters: Wilmington, Delaware, USA
Key Offering: Affordable research nanomaterials
Nanoshel provides accessible nanoparticle solutions to universities and startups worldwide, playing a crucial role in democratizing nanotechnology research and development.
Technology Initiatives:
- Academic discount programs
- Small-batch custom synthesis
- Educational material development

📈 Market Outlook: Nanotechnology’s Accelerating Impact
The silicon oxide nanoparticle market is experiencing transformative growth as these materials become fundamental building blocks across industries. Key trends shaping the sector include:
- Semiconductor miniaturization: 3nm node technologies demand ultra-pure colloidal silica
- Biomedical breakthroughs: Targeted drug delivery systems show 40% efficacy improvements
- Energy applications: Solar cell efficiency boosted by 22% using nanoparticle coatings
- Environmental solutions: Nanoparticle filters remove 99.97% of water contaminants
Regional dynamics show Asia-Pacific growing at 8.2% CAGR through 2030, while North America maintains technology leadership in specialized applications. Production costs are declining approximately 9% annually as synthesis methods improve.
📊 Industry Challenges:
- Regulatory uncertainty surrounding nanoparticle safety
- Talent shortage in nanomaterial engineering
- Capital intensity of production scale-up
